Description aryeh.friedman 2018-10-31 23:55:18 UTC
Firefox 63.0.1_1 (on 11.2-release) refuses to open *ANY* site/url when attempting the following message is sent to the console:

###!!! [Parent][MessageChannel] Error: (msgtype=0x190084,name=PBrowser::Msg_Destroy) Channel error: cannot send/recv

For referemce:

This is r483632 from svn and the machine is:

FreeBSD lilith 11.2-RELEASE-p4 FreeBSD 11.2-RELEASE-p4 #0 r339065: Mon Oct  1 14:01:40 EDT 2018     root@lilith:/usr/obj/usr/src/sys/GENERIC  amd64
